02

再论iPhone Push Notification:腰身柔软易推倒?

by newkhonsou@twitter

这示意图省略了什么?

感谢@lawrencelry邀请我参加CocoaHeads的活动,有幸碰到iCHM和Buddyfeed的作者@RobinLu。我们三个人讨论了一下苹果的Push,内容总结于下文。

———————————–

技术:表情痛苦算站稳

首先,推送的本质是一个服务。所以如果不考虑手机厂商和运营商之间的利益争夺,由运营商实现Push最为理想。这个世界上最好的推送服务,由黑莓和运营商合作提供,不是偶然。

而苹果和Nokia等厂商则决心走另外一条路:绕过运营商。

一个“绕”字,表现出这种方案的尴尬之处。不过,技术的发展和移动网络的普及,让这个目标越来越现实。Push Notification的幕后一文,分析了苹果的Push方案。但那个解释并不完整。他只叙述了从苹果到用户这一段。@RobinLu作为开发者,为我们补完了Push拼图中的另外一块:从开发者到苹果

原来,除了苹果的Push Server以外,开发者必须自己维护另外一个Web Server,用来收集自己程序产生的推送,并且把他发给苹果的Push Server。

简要的说明如下图。点击放大

ApplePush

假设,BuddyFeed要支持Push的话。。。

一个BuddyFeed用户发送一个评论,首先在FriendFeed.com提交更新。之后,开发者维护的WebServer会从iPhone的BuddyFeed客户端(或者从FriendFeed.com),得到这个更新的通知。

开发者接收这个通知的服务器,上图中称作App Push Web Server。处理这个通知,变为苹果 Push Server可接受的标准形式,发送给苹果。苹果的Push Server再用Push Notification的幕后一文叙述的方式,把这个消息推送给用户。

———————————–

商业:腰身柔软易推倒

技术上还算完整?但是结合商业考量,就不是那么妙了。

这套方案需要开发者维护一个Web Server。这是个持续的开支。而看看App Store上Push程序的售价,绝大多数都是一次性付款。

IM+:$4.99,Boxcar:$2.99,GPush:$0.99!

考虑一下软件的销售额和他产生流量的关系吧。销售额升升降降都属正常,而Web Server所服务的用户,永远都是增长的!!!更多用户,等于更多流量,等于更多带宽,等于持续增长的昂贵的服务器租金。随着时间推移,当用户已经非常庞大的时候,软件的销售又趋于饱和,开发者会做出什么选择?

向已经购买该软件的用户再次收费,或者,干脆关掉他维护的Web Server!!!

苹果的Push的实现潦草的令人发指。新通知覆盖了旧的,你面对好几个程序上的红色数字,都不知道去哪里找。但是,这种设计上的问题更加致命。当销售下降到不能维持Web Server的月租金,那些廉价Push软件,以何为继?

———————————–

出路?

苹果Push Notification的出路至少有三条:

一是苹果提供为开发者提供App Push Server。

二是In App Purchases,按月收费。

三是Push广告。

目前,App Store中,已经有Push软件选择了方式二,比如Tweet Push。虽然,他更可能提供可靠而长久服务,但无论评价还是人气,都远远没有一次付费的Push软件好。

———————————–

甚至机会?个人SaaS?

ERP等企业级别的应用发展出一个概念:SaaS。Software as a Service(软件即服务)。不再销售软件,而是销售一套基于Web和软件的有弹性的解决方案,并提供支持。为此,收取月/年租。SaaS应用的这种收费方式,已经被企业广泛接受。

本文开头说过,Push即服务。iPhone上Push的实现,其实就是这种企业级概念向个人下放的结果。其实今天的个人用户中,也有大量在付费购买服务。传统网络上,有Flickr Pro的账户。移动网络上,日本大量的用户缴350日元/月得到MMS的同时享受Push Mail。黑莓BIS的用户也不少。

为iPhone用户提供高质量的Push服务,并且按月收费,也许会成为将来市场的常态。

但是苹果Push技术说明上的语焉不详,让普通用户不容易接受月租方式。Push实现的潦草,让Push本来应该体现的价值打了折扣。App Store中廉价风和价格战,更让坚持月租方式的开发者难以出头。

以上种种,都在损害这个机会。

智能手机和其上的应用市场是全新的,高速成长的领域。从iPhone到App Store,苹果难得的在设计创新的同时,实现也保持了非常高的水准。但是不得不说,Push的设计和实现,不配这个评价。

但是,相信无论苹果还是开发者,都在寻找更好的办法。苹果对Push的改进不会停止。而App Store的模式,最终应能让提供完善方案的,负责任的开发者,脱颖而出。

时间将检验一切。

↓ 和朋友分享,开始 Web 2.0,点击图标 ↓
  • Print
  • email
  • RSS
  • Facebook
  • Digg
  • FriendFeed
  • 豆瓣
  • Google Bookmarks
  • QQ书签
  • Add to favorites
  • del.icio.us
  • 豆瓣九点

2 条评论了已经

Trackbacks/Pingbacks.

发表评论

名字(必须)
邮箱(不会被公布)(必须)
网址

字体为 粗体 是必填项目,邮箱地址 永远不会 公布。

允许部分 HTML 代码:
<a href="" title=""> <abbr title=""> <acronym title=""> <b> <blockquote cite=""> <cite> <code> <del datetime=""> <em> <i> <q cite=""> <strike> <strong>
URLs(网站链接)必须完整有效 (比如: http://www.ifanr.com),所有标签都必须完整的关闭。

超出部分系统将会自动分段及换行。

请保证评论内容是与日志或 Blog 内容相关的,灌水、攻击性或不恰当的评论 可能 会被编辑或删除。

    小众论坛

    猫窝论坛

    分类目录

    最新评论

    • LZ是个苹果迷 »
    • 对于一个没有用过Iphone也不确定会不会在Iphone 4.0发布多任务系统甚至在Iphone上连换电池都成为奢望的人而言,N1 是一个很值得考虑的选择,最起码它可以是一个支持开源且有尊严的Geek... »
    • 雅虎做什么都是慢一拍,当年几个巨头,它发展的是最不好的 »
    • 在诺基亚官网看过,不过还是希望博主能专门介绍下QT »
    • iPhone不是一般的好用- - »
    • 不知道能不能读到一些报纸?感觉如何捏 »
    • bold.oliver 发表于 Nook 使用一周后的感受
      LS難道蘋果的東西不普及嗎?不在中國普及不代表不在其他地方普及啊。還有,FML小組。。。囧了。剛去看了一下,很不錯!非常好啊,這個項目要做下去~~ »
    • 这篇文章不看也罢 »
    • google除了搜索做的好,其他的用户体验做的很烂,很烂,很烂,真的很烂。google过于重视简洁的概念,这个在搜索上是可以的,但是推广到其他方面就会对用户体验带来致命打击。比如chrome,感觉就是... »
    • 套用别人的一句话“再好的硬件都比不上众多好的软件的支持” »
    • M8的独到之处在于有自己的SDK,这样就可以开软件商店了。像HTC那种做个界面的策略,不但外光里不光,而且永远只是做做硬件组装给微软打工。 »
    • 我觉得分析的太到位了,我给我老婆买的是HTC Magic,她用了一段时间不喜欢了,主要是因为操作系统太慢了,用户界面好多地方设计的不人性,比如添加联系人就很麻烦。我觉得操作系统进化应该伴随着用户界面的... »
    • eric 发表于 webOS: QT 软件来喽
      webos和nokia的商务人员早干嘛去了,明显的双赢局面 »
    • “我强烈认为iPad有是最好的操作系统,最好的操作界面,最好的人性设计,最好的掌上多媒体平台,但他绝对不是最好的读书工具,因为他没有电子墨水屏幕。”我不希望iFanr走向极端,苹果的东西如果真的好早就... »
    • 怎么没有说到 X61T 和 X201T 呢, 虽然是不是能够称作平板见仁见智, 但它们绝对是世界上最强大的 Windows OS 触控设备.. »
    • yucca 发表于 webOS: QT 软件来喽
      to lordhong:出新机也未必会火,谁都看的出来,palm的问题是普及度,只是出新机,只能是窝里斗,降低pre原本微薄的占有率,为什么人家apple不急着出新机,出了也不变就是保持统一,palm... »
    • 绝对赞同拥护 BGR 的观点. 但是译者你文末的例子就不是什么好例子了. 事实上是有一个"Confirm delete"的勾选菜单在 Setting 里. 然后你 delete 的邮件也可以从 tra... »
    • 这里图上的bb 8310跟我的一样啊:) »
    • 楼上的,Notion Ink Adam那个图里面用的是rainmeter,win下的桌面美化软件,不过那个图太假了,说了是android了 »
    • 已重新上传,appspot时不时就被墙 »

    推荐阅读

      订阅到iGoogle或Google Reader 订阅到鲜果 订阅到抓虾 订阅到飞鸽 订阅到Bloglines 订阅到我的雅虎 订阅到NetVibes 订阅到Newsgatar 订阅到Rojo 订阅到网易有道 通过哪吒订阅到MSN,Gtalk,Skype 订阅到QQ邮箱

    @范小叨

    • 自己建 twip api 吧.
    • 抱歉,叨扰大家了。我们不认识 ,和他亦从无私下接触和交往。但我们这两天对 gravity 和 9700 做过评价,随之引发他对我们恶毒定性。如此仇恨,应非一时戏言,此类阴暗,亦必有缘由,但此事到此为止,我们将不再对此继续发推,也请诸君见谅。
    • twitter 亦万象. 有喜欢制定真理, 管理宇宙的, 凡不符合其"规范", 威胁 unfollow 为一例( ), 不知其为何物. 有不堪忍受别人舒爽, 却又喜窥视的, 屡愤懑忧郁不竭, 欲人供其神. 人性之丑恶, 可一观, 共勉.
    • 这就有意思了, ifanr 不认识你, 如果你不是"主动"贴着咱, 我们花这个功夫孝顺你? 你既然不喜欢我们, 整天又关心, 呵护我们做甚? 我们又不是为你推的... RT : 你神经病啊?我不喜欢你,你整天恬着个逼脸跟我啰嗦什么?
    • 威胁说凡 RT 推的,就 Unfollow,搞得群众很惊慌。不知道会不会因为 ifanr 继续上推就愤而退出 twitter 呢? RT : 啥情况啊? RT : 我们讨论机型和平台的区别,你着急啥呢?
    • 我们讨论机型和平台的区别,你着急啥呢? RT : 谁rt ifanr我就跟谁说拜拜,说到做到。弱智还弱出尊严来了,真是受不了。
    • gmail 有官方的黑莓客户端
    • push 也非万能。很多人推崇尚邮,它在黑莓上达到 pushmail 的相似效果。但是支持对话式展示的 gmail 手机客户端更为讨好,特别是对于大量群组邮件交互的情况下。9700 无法对我大量邮件往来的使用场景提供很好的用户体验。#ifanring
    • 对于中文移动用户,没有 BES/BIS 和好的中文输入法及网络浏览器的黑莓近似传说。如果抛却品牌和小众迷恋,看不出理性的选择会偏向黑莓。9700 流畅的系统,软硬件高度集成,屏幕显示和安全性很棒,但是网络服务和软件应用的不足,让整体逊色不少。#ifanring
    • 9700 的触控板体验比我相象的好很多,经过几天的适应,我已经可以非常精确地使用它了.相比之下,E72 的触控板凹陷的设计体验极差.粗砺感不说,操作的流畅性也差距甚远.#9700

    随机文章

    友链

    功能

    小众论坛

    爱段子